27 /* Language-dependent contents of an identifier. */
28
29 /* The limbo_value is used for block level extern declarations, which need
30 to be type checked against subsequent extern declarations. They can't
31 be referenced after they fall out of scope, so they can't be global.
32
33 The rid_code field is used for keywords. It is in all
34 lang_identifier nodes, because some keywords are only special in a
35 particular context. */
36
37 struct lang_identifier
38 {
39 struct c_common_identifier ignore;
40 tree global_value, local_value, label_value, implicit_decl;
41 tree error_locus, limbo_value;
42 };
43
44 /* Language-specific declaration information. */
45
46 struct lang_decl
47 {
48 struct c_lang_decl base;
49 /* The return types and parameter types may have variable size.
50 This is a list of any SAVE_EXPRs that need to be evaluated to
51 compute those sizes. */
52 tree pending_sizes;
53 };
54
55 /* Macros for access to language-specific slots in an identifier. */
56 /* Each of these slots contains a DECL node or null. */
57
58 /* This represents the value which the identifier has in the
59 file-scope namespace. */
60 #define IDENTIFIER_GLOBAL_VALUE(NODE) \
61 (((struct lang_identifier *) (NODE))->global_value)
62 /* This represents the value which the identifier has in the current
63 scope. */
64 #define IDENTIFIER_LOCAL_VALUE(NODE) \
65 (((struct lang_identifier *) (NODE))->local_value)
66 /* This represents the value which the identifier has as a label in
67 the current label scope. */
68 #define IDENTIFIER_LABEL_VALUE(NODE) \
69 (((struct lang_identifier *) (NODE))->label_value)
70 /* This records the extern decl of this identifier, if it has had one
71 at any point in this compilation. */
72 #define IDENTIFIER_LIMBO_VALUE(NODE) \
73 (((struct lang_identifier *) (NODE))->limbo_value)
74 /* This records the implicit function decl of this identifier, if it
75 has had one at any point in this compilation. */
76 #define IDENTIFIER_IMPLICIT_DECL(NODE) \
77 (((struct lang_identifier *) (NODE))->implicit_decl)
78 /* This is the last function in which we printed an "undefined variable"
79 message for this identifier. Value is a FUNCTION_DECL or null. */
80 #define IDENTIFIER_ERROR_LOCUS(NODE) \
81 (((struct lang_identifier *) (NODE))->error_locus)
82
83 /* In identifiers, C uses the following fields in a special way:
84 TREE_PUBLIC to record that there was a previous local extern decl.
85 TREE_USED to record that such a decl was used.
86 TREE_ADDRESSABLE to record that the address of such a decl was used. */
87
88 /* In a RECORD_TYPE or UNION_TYPE, nonzero if any component is read-only. */
89 #define C_TYPE_FIELDS_READONLY(type) TREE_LANG_FLAG_1 (type)
90
91 /* In a RECORD_TYPE or UNION_TYPE, nonzero if any component is volatile. */
92 #define C_TYPE_FIELDS_VOLATILE(type) TREE_LANG_FLAG_2 (type)
93
94 /* In a RECORD_TYPE or UNION_TYPE or ENUMERAL_TYPE
95 nonzero if the definition of the type has already started. */
96 #define C_TYPE_BEING_DEFINED(type) TYPE_LANG_FLAG_0 (type)
97
98 /* In an IDENTIFIER_NODE, nonzero if this identifier is actually a
99 keyword. C_RID_CODE (node) is then the RID_* value of the keyword,
100 and C_RID_YYCODE is the token number wanted by Yacc. */
101
102 #define C_IS_RESERVED_WORD(id) TREE_LANG_FLAG_0 (id)
103
104 /* In a RECORD_TYPE, a sorted array of the fields of the type. */
105 struct lang_type
106 {
107 int len;
108 tree elts[1];
109 };
110
111 /* Record whether a type or decl was written with nonconstant size.
112 Note that TYPE_SIZE may have simplified to a constant. */
113 #define C_TYPE_VARIABLE_SIZE(type) TYPE_LANG_FLAG_1 (type)
114 #define C_DECL_VARIABLE_SIZE(type) DECL_LANG_FLAG_0 (type)
115
116 #if 0 /* Not used. */
117 /* Record whether a decl for a function or function pointer has
118 already been mentioned (in a warning) because it was called
119 but didn't have a prototype. */
120 #define C_MISSING_PROTOTYPE_WARNED(decl) DECL_LANG_FLAG_2(decl)
121 #endif
122
123 /* Store a value in that field. */
124 #define C_SET_EXP_ORIGINAL_CODE(exp, code) \
125 (TREE_COMPLEXITY (exp) = (int) (code))
126
127 /* Record whether a typedef for type `int' was actually `signed int'. */
128 #define C_TYPEDEF_EXPLICITLY_SIGNED(exp) DECL_LANG_FLAG_1 ((exp))
129
130 /* Nonzero for a declaration of a built in function if there has been no
131 occasion that would declare the function in ordinary C.
132 Using the function draws a pedantic warning in this case. */
133 #define C_DECL_ANTICIPATED(exp) DECL_LANG_FLAG_3 ((exp))
134
135 /* For FUNCTION_TYPE, a hidden list of types of arguments. The same as
136 TYPE_ARG_TYPES for functions with prototypes, but created for functions
137 without prototypes. */
138 #define TYPE_ACTUAL_ARG_TYPES(NODE) TYPE_NONCOPIED_PARTS (NODE)
